What is Findology.IM? Findoogy.IM is a cross-platform instant messaging application that allows users to chat across all major IM networks – AOL Instant Messenger, MSN Messenger, Yahoo Messenger, and ICQ. |
|
 |
 |
What do I need to use Findology.IM? Findology.IM requires Microsoft Windows (98, 98SE, Me, NT, 2000, or XP) in order to be installed. An Internet connection is required to connect to the various IM networks. |

How do I start using Findology.IM? Once Findology.IM is installed, using it is a snap. Simply click “Start,” navigate to “Programs,” and then Findology.IM. |
|
 |
 |
How do I send an instant message? An instant message can be sent by double-clicking the left button of the mouse on the desired contact in the list of contacts in the main window. |
|
 |
 |
How do I uninstall Findology.IM? Findology.IM provides an uninstall utility from the Windows Add/Remove Programs menu. |

How can I change the color of my text? To change the color of your text, just use the appropriate text buttons in the IM window. Any and all changes made will apply only to the current IM from which the change was made. |
|
 |
 |
Will having the regular IM clients installed create problems with Findology.IM? Absolutely not. Keeping the native IM clients will pose no problems to Findology.IM. |
